Doctors should routinely ask adult patients whether they feel stressed, says the lead author of a recent report on stress management in primary care. Aditi Nerurkar, HMS instructor in medicine at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center is the lead author, and Russell S. Phillips, HMS professor of medicine at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center and director of the Harvard Medical School Center for Primary Care, is a co-author of the study.
